Flip Wilson, the popular comedian who became the first black entertainer to be the host of a successful weekly variety show on network television, died last night at his home in Malibu, Calif. Wilson's characters included Reverend Leroy, the materialistic pastor of the "Church of Whats Happening Now", and his most popular character, Geraldine Jones, who frequently referred to her unseen boyfriend, "Killer", and whose lines "The devil made me do it" as well as "What you see is what you get" became national catchphrases.
